Mesothelioma Attorneys

A mesothelioma attorney can help families and victims receive compensation from the asbestos trust fund. Companies that make asbestos-containing products have set aside billions of dollars.

Attorneys can assist victims throughout the legal process, from identifying potential exposure sites to filing a lawsuit. A national firm will be able to comprehend the limitations of state statutes and ensure that clients don't exceed their deadlines.

Legal help for mesothelioma can be crucial in beating the cancer that is aggressive. Asbestos-related victims are often left with large medical bills and a limited life expectancy, making Mesothelioma compensation (www.Tractiontoolkit.org) an important method of paying for treatment. Compensation can cover lost wages, travel costs to treatments, or support for family members.

Depending on the kind of mesothelioma that is diagnosed, a victim can pursue compensation through personal injury or wrongful death lawsuits. These claims can be brought against asbestos companies that are responsible for the victim’s exposure. In the past, many mesothelioma sufferers filed class action lawsuits. These types of lawsuits are becoming less popular in recent years because they tend to offer victims lower compensation.

A mesothelioma lawyer can assist veterans in filing VA benefits for mesothelioma. Compensation from the VA can be used to pay for mesothelioma treatment, caregiver costs and other costs. A mesothelioma lawyer team can also examine medical records and research asbestos trust funds to determine the most effective financial aid.

Mesothelioma is a fatal cancer that is caused by exposure to asbestos an element that occurs naturally in. Asbestos is a component of many popular consumer products like insulation, fireproofing materials, and ceiling tiles. Exposure to asbestos can lead to many health problems, including respiratory illnesses and mesothelioma. It could take a long time for exposure to asbestos to lead to mesothelioma.

Asbestos sufferers could be awarded a substantial amount of money to pay for their medical expenses. The money could be used to pay for the cost of life-altering treatments like chemotherapy or surgery, as well as other expensive procedures. Compensation can also be paid for pain and suffering, as well as other types of damages.

When a person dies from mesothelioma or other cancers, the family members or estate representatives can make a wrongful-death lawsuit against the negligent asbestos companies that caused the victim's exposure. This lawsuit could compensate for funeral costs, financial and emotional losses, and future income loss.

Many asbestos-related companies have declared bankruptcy, and some have established bankruptcy trusts for victims of asbestos-related diseases. A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ced will know how to use trust funds to obtain the amount you are due. They will also prepare all the necessary documents to be presented to the appropriate trustees. They will ensure that your bankruptcy case is processed quickly.
